Rahane, who made his Test debut against Australia at New Delhi in 2013, had carved a reputation for himself as being one of India’s dependable batters in overseas conditions, as seen from eight of his 12 Test centuries coming outside of home.
However, a dip in form despite making a fantastic century against Australia in the 2020 Boxing Day Test and leading India to an unforgettable 2-1 Border-Gavaskar Trophy triumph, meant Rahane was last seen in the format in January 2022 against South Africa at Cape Town, where he had scores of 9 and 1.
After accumulating 136 runs in six innings as India lost the series 2-1 against Proteas, Rahane was left out of the Test squad for the home series against Sri Lanka.
Injuries to Shreyas Iyer and Rishabh Pant leading to a hole in the Indian middle-order along with his sizzling form in Ipl 2023, played a hand in Rahane’s return to the Test squad after 14 months.

New Delhi, Dec 30 (Ians) The results of India wicketkeeper Rishabh Pant’s Mri of the brain and spine are normal, said a medical bulletin, after the cricketer suffered in a serious car accident near Roorkee, Uttarakhand on Friday morning.
The 25-year old has also undergone plastic surgery to manage his facial injuries, lacerated wounds and abrasions while the Mri scans of his ankle and knee have been postponed till Saturday because of pain and swelling.
According to an ESPNcricinfo report, the doctors at Max Hospital in Dehradun have also given him “above knee splintage … for suspected right knee ligament injury, and suspected right ankle ligament injury”.
The medical bulletin released by the hospital on Friday evening also said Pant is “stable, conscious and oriented”, the report further said.
Earlier in the day, Bcci had also released a statement, saying that Rishabh has two cuts on his forehead, a ligament tear...

New Delhi, Dec 30 (Ians) India’s wicketkeeper-batter Rishabh Pant has suffered two cuts on his forehead, apart from a ligament tear in his right knee, abrasion injuries on back, and hurting right wrist, ankle, and toe, said Jay Shah, the Honorary Secretary of the Board of Control for Cricket in India (Bcci), in an official statement on Friday.
Early on Friday morning, Pant, 25, suffered multiple injuries when his car collided with a road divider and caught fire on the Delhi-Dehradun highway. He has been admitted to Max Hospital in Dehradun after being initially taken to Saksham Hospital Multispecialty and Trauma Centre. Pant was on his way to his hometown Roorkee in the state of Uttarakhand from New Delhi.
“Rishabh has two cuts on his forehead, a ligament tear in his right knee and has also hurt his right wrist, ankle, and toe and has suffered abrasion injuries on his back.

Christchurch, Dec 1 (Ians) India’s stand-in Odi skipper Shikhar Dhawan stated that in backing Rishabh Pant over Sanju Samson, one has to see the larger picture on who is a “match-winner” and has to be “backed” by the team management.
In India’s 1-0 series loss, Pant’s lean form and Samson’s exclusion from the playing eleven grabbed headlines. In his last nine innings across white-ball matches for India, Pant had scores of 10, 15, 11, 6, 6, 3, 9, 9 and 27.
Samson, on the other hand, entered the series against New Zealand after being unbeaten in the home Odi series against South Africa. He also hit a fine 36 in the first Odi at Auckland, but was kept out of playing eleven for the next two matches as India preferred Deepak Hooda for sixth bowling option quota.
“It wasn’t that tough. For example, Rishabh played and scored a hundred in England, so we had to back him.

Actor-filmmaker Rishab Shetty’s latest Kannada film ‘Kantara’ has broken the record of Yash-starrer ‘Kgf 2’ and has come out victorious by becoming the highest-rated Indian film on IMDb. The film, which released on September 30, is an action-thriller written and directed by Rishabh and produced by Vijay Kiragandur.
According to IMDb, the film has a rating of 9.5/10. ‘Kgf-2’ has been rated with 8.4 and ‘Rrr’ has 8.0.
Set and filmed in Keraadi in coastal Karnataka, the film stars Rishabh as a Kambala champion, who is at loggerheads with an upright Drfo officer, Murali (Kishore).
The Hindi-dubbed version of the film will be released on October 14.
